50 years ago: Beatles song aimed at U.S. market hit No. 1

Today's Morning Edition music selection comes from "Bad Boy," a track from "The Beatles Six," which was the No. 1 album on the U.S. Billboard pop chart 50 years ago today.

"Bad Boy" was one of two songs written by Larry Williams that the Beatles recorded and put on an album specifically for the U.S. market. The other was "Dizzy Miss Lizzie." John Lennon sang both songs.
